San Jose Sharks general manager Mike Grier showed patience in trading Erik Karlsson to the Pittsburgh Penguins in a multi-player, three-team trade. The Sharks received forwards Mike Hoffman and Mikael Granlund, defenseman Jan Rutta, and Pittsburgh's first-round pick next season. The trade benefits the Sharks in the long term as they come out of their rebuild.

Emoni Bates wanted to be drafted by the Memphis Grizzlies, but ended up with the Cleveland Cavaliers. Bates is happy with the Cavs and feels they have reignited his love for the game. He appreciates being able to focus on playing rather than generating attention. Bates has a relationship with Ja Morant, who plays for the Grizzlies, and they stay in touch. Bates had a troubled past with a gun charge, but it was dropped and he was reinstated to play college basketball. He had a strong showing in a Summer League game against the Grizzlies. The Cavs are pleased to have Bates on the team and believe he will fit well with their revamped offense.
